This Vintage Ships Clock with Kompas Rijeka Dial comes from a working vessel – possibly a ship, boat, or submarine. It likely dates back to the period when Rijeka was still part of Yugoslavia. The clock face displays “KOMPAS” (Croatian for compass) and “RIJEKA,” a well-known port city on the Adriatic Sea.
At just about one pound, the clock is lightweight and easy to move or display. You’ll notice signs of wear on the surface, which give it a distinct, weathered look. These marks speak to its age and use at sea. The battery compartment remains intact; however, we haven’t tested it, so it’s being sold as-is.
